Marvin Wilson, DL, Florida State

Marvin Wilson comes out of Florida State with a lack of production and kind of a disappointing college career. This was a guy highly recruited out of High School before going onto his collegiate career. Expectations were high but he was not able to stay healthy or produce at a high level. This past season was primed to be a big one for him as the hope was he could show up big for the Seminoles but that did not happen.

Wilson suffered a season-ending injury and couldn’t show NFL scouts much more than his previous years. This is going to be a huge week for him as scouts will need to see a lot from him so his name moves up draft boards.

The pedigree is there for this player but he still hasn’t shown the consistency most would want. As of now, Wilson seems to be a true nose tackle in the NFL and that is not the worst thing in the world. The Steelers might need a true nose tackle if Tyson Alualu leaves via free agency. Depth will be needed across that front and Wilson would be a nice get in the mid to late rounds of the draft. He is still a monster in the middle that can play the run extremely well. He needs to improve in the pass-rush column though.
